2. Human body obesity
In recent years, the incidence of obesity has risen year by year and has become a social problem that affects people's physical and mental health.The obese people did not have obvious conscious symptoms in the early days, but there were many hidden dangers, especially male obesity, which would affect the development of reproductive systems such as testicles and penis.Its pathogenesis is that adipose tissue has the characteristics of transformingrogestyls into estrogen, reduces male androgen in men, increases estrogen relatively, hinders sperm production and affects sperm quality.Obese can also induce hypertension and diabetes, which can cause physical dysfunction.

5. Nuclear heat radiation
Nuclear radiation is more destructive for testicles.Because testicles are one of the most sensitive organs in nuclear radiation in human organs.Low doses can also reduce sperm quality, and even cause temporary spermless.Some experts estimate that the radiation dose of 200 & mdash; 300 Lunqin can cause dysfunction.X -rays can cause sperm malformations, decreased quality, small dose X -ray irradiation can destroy the genetic genes of sperm cells, or cause sperm head abnormalities, causing fetal malformations, abortion, premature birth or mental retardation; heat radiation is also important to cause sperm quality.reason.Experts believe that if the temperature of the testis is more than 45 ° C, it can hinder sperm production and sperm activity in two hours.Sauna baths, bathing with overheated water, high temperature operations, wearing tight pants, etc., can damage the ability of testicular to make sperm and sperm activity.

How to improve the number and quality of sperm?
1. Adjust the diet: Eating more green vegetables can help improve the quality of sperm, because green vegetables contain vitamin C, vitamin E, zinc, selenium and other ingredients that are conducive to sperm growth.Nuts and fish are rich in Omega 3 fatty acids and should also eat more. These are good for sperm cell growth.
2. Pay attention to exercise: The excessive obesity of the male body will cause the temperature at the groin to rise and damage the growth of sperm, which will lead to infertility.Therefore, weight control can improve the quality of sperm within the standard range.However, the intensity of exercise should be moderate, and the temperature of the severe exercise will increase the temperature and destroy the cool environment required for sperm growth.
3. Supplementary trace elements: zinc supplementation has a certain effect on less sperm and dead sperm. The number of sperm after taking the medicine has increased significantly. Through this method, it can effectively treat sperm vitality.
4. Supplementary arginine: arginine is a necessary component to generate sperm. In the semen of patients with young sperm, amino acid content is significantly lower than normal men.
5. Smoking and alcohol: Smoking and alcoholism are the enemy of sperm.Some men's bodies are quite sensitive to toxins in cigarettes, and nicotine in cigarettes can kill sperm.A chemist in Australia said that once men quit smoking, sexuality in blood will increase.
